I have two FRDM-KL25 boards, I installed CW 10.3 and The Kinetis L sample code. Using the instructions in the FRDM-KL25Z-QSP document I compiled and ran the hello-world application without incident. When I try the other samples in the same folder they all fail with errors like:
Description Resource Path Location Type
ARM_GCC_Support/ewl/EWL_C/src/sys/uart_console_io.c undefined reference to `WriteUARTN' accelerometer_demo line 151 C/C++ Problem
or:
Description Resource Path Location Type
mingw32-make: *** [accelerometer_demo.elf] Error 1 accelerometer_demo C/C++ Problem
Sample programs that fail are never a good sign. Can I expect an update soon?

Hi,
KL25_sc provides CW examples using Processor Expert (PEx) tool, one of this examples is accelerometer_demo which is in projects folder. PEx projects needs to generate the code for each component. That is why CW compiler does not find some UART functions or others.
You need to Generate Processor Expert Code:
2. Wait......
3. Compile again.
Hope this helps.
Also, the reason WriteUARTN() is required is because of the ANSI library. Erich has a great post discussing using the ANSI library in CW10 at this link:
